Creating a web game has become an increasingly popular venture for many developers and entrepreneurs. With the rise of online gaming, many are curious about the costs involved in bringing a web game to life. In this article, we will explore the various aspects that determine the cost of developing a web game, including design, development, marketing, and maintenance.

Understanding the Types of Web Games

Before diving into costs, it’s essential to understand the different types of web games that can be developed. Web games can range from simple browser-based games to complex multiplayer environments. The cost can vary significantly based on the type of game you choose to create.

  1. Casual Games: These are simple to play and often require minimal graphics and coding. They are designed for short play sessions and can be created relatively quickly and inexpensively.

  2. Role-Playing Games (RPGs): RPGs typically involve more complex game mechanics, storylines, and character development. As such, the cost of development is higher than that of casual games.

  3. Multiplayer Games: These games allow numerous players to interact within a shared virtual environment. Development for multiplayer games can be complex and usually requires a more significant investment.

  4. Educational Games: These games aim to teach users while entertaining them. While the gameplay might not be as complex, the cost can increase if you require specialized content or features.

Factors Influencing the Costs

1. Game Design

The design phase is critical in establishing the look and feel of your game. Costs associated with game design include:

  • Graphic Design: This involves creating characters, environments, and user interfaces. Depending on the complexity, hiring a designer can range from a few hundred to several thousand dollars.

  • Sound Design: Sound effects and background music are vital for enhancing the gaming experience. Costs for sound design can vary based on whether you opt for custom compositions or stock audio files.

2. Development Costs

The development phase incorporates building the game engine, programming, and integrating various elements such as graphics and sound. Key factors include:

  • Platform Choice: Developing for multiple platforms (PC, mobile, etc.) can raise costs. Each platform may require a different version or adaptation of the game.

  • Development Team: Hiring a development team can be one of the most significant expenses. This might include programmers, artists, and project managers. Typical rates can vary greatly, but a small team can range from \(30,000 to over \)150,000 for a medium-sized game.

3. Technology Stack

The choice of technology stack also influences costs. You can opt for existing game engines such as Unity or Unreal Engine, which can help streamline development but may come with licensing fees. Alternatively, building a game from scratch could be more expensive but offers greater flexibility.

4. Testing and QA

Quality Assurance (QA) is crucial for a successful game launch. Costs involved can include:

  • Bug Testing: Identifying and fixing bugs in the game before launch is essential and can cost anywhere from \(5,000 to \)20,000 depending on the game’s complexity.

  • User Testing: Getting feedback from players during the testing phase can aid in making necessary adjustments. There are various user testing services that charge based on the demographic reach and depth of feedback required.

5. Marketing Expenses

Once your game is developed, you will need to market it effectively to reach your target audience. Marketing expenses can include:

  • Advertising: This includes social media ads, Google Ads, or influencer partnerships. Effective campaigns can range from \(5,000 to \)50,000 or more.

  • Community Building: Engaging potential players through social media, forums, or Discord servers can also incur costs, depending on the resources and time invested.

6. Maintenance and Updates

After launching your web game, maintenance and consistent updates are necessary to keep the player base engaged and to fix ongoing issues. This can cost on an annual basis:

  • Server Costs: If your game requires online servers for multiplayer experiences, these costs can add up, potentially reaching several thousand dollars per year based on the server capacity needed.

  • Content Updates: Regularly providing new content or features is crucial for player retention and can spell additional costs for development and design.

Total Estimated Costs

After considering all these factors, the total cost of developing a web game can vary widely. To give a rough estimate:

  • Small Casual Game: \(5,000 to \)15,000
  • Medium-Sized RPG or Multiplayer Game: \(30,000 to \)150,000
  • Large Scale Game with Extensive Features: $150,000 and above

As you can see, the cost varies based on various components involved in development. Each decision influences the overall budget, and understanding these intricacies is vital before embarking on a game development journey.

Conclusion

In conclusion, developing a web game can be a rewarding but complex process with costs that can range significantly based on various factors. Whether you’re creating a simple browser game or an intricate multiplayer experience, proper planning and budgeting are crucial to bring your vision to life. By considering all aspects, from design to ongoing maintenance, you can better estimate the financial outlay required to create a successful web game.